The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 97820 zip code. The total population is 1016, of which, 491 are male and 525 are female. With a total area of 899 square miles, the population density is 1 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 56.5 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ics
The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 97820 zip code is $54844. This is -30.54% less than the national average. This income places 6.6%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$16472. Education
In the 97820 zip code, 97.6%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 24.1% have a bachelors degree or higher. Additionally, 10.4% of individuals 3 years and older are in private school, and 89.6% are in public school. The data below outline the education level breakdown, degree field breakdown, and more.
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 97820 zip, there are an estimated 498 people in the labor force, of which, 430 are employed, and 68 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 11.3 minutes. Of the total people that work, 34 worked from home and 428 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 38. Housing
The median home value for the 97820 zip code is 180700. There is an estimated 462 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$710 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$726.
